在当今这个多设备互联的时代,用户常常需要在不同类型的设备之间无缝切换和使用数据。对于Linux用户来说,Pop!_OS是一个备受推崇的操作系统,它以其简洁的设计和强大的性能吸引了大量用户。而安卓设备,作为全球最流行的智能手机操作系统,同样拥有庞大的用户群体。本文将探讨如何打破设备界限,实现Pop!_OS与安卓设备之间的无缝同步。

一、Pop!_OS简介

Pop!_OS是由System76开发的一款基于Ubuntu的Linux发行版,它以其优雅的界面、简洁的设置和预装的应用程序而受到用户喜爱。Pop!_OS不仅提供了良好的用户体验,还针对开发者和创意专业人士进行了优化。

1.1 Pop!_OS的特点

  • 流畅的图形界面:Pop!_OS提供了Unity桌面环境,用户界面直观,易于使用。
  • 预装软件:Pop!_OS预装了各种应用程序,如代码编辑器、音乐播放器和视频编辑软件等。
  • 性能优化:Pop!_OS针对性能进行了优化,能够提供流畅的多任务处理体验。

二、安卓设备同步的挑战

虽然安卓和Pop!_OS都由同一公司(Canonical)支持,但它们之间的同步仍然存在一些挑战。以下是实现同步需要克服的几个关键问题:

2.1 数据兼容性

安卓和Pop!_OS使用不同的文件系统和数据格式,这可能导致数据无法直接访问。

2.2 软件兼容性

由于操作系统之间的差异,某些应用程序可能在另一个操作系统上无法运行。

2.3 用户习惯

用户需要适应不同操作系统的使用习惯和界面布局。

三、实现Pop!_OS与安卓设备同步的方法

尽管存在挑战,但以下方法可以帮助用户实现Pop!_OS与安卓设备之间的无缝同步:

3.1 使用Google账户同步

Google账户可以为用户提供一个中心化的数据存储解决方案。以下是使用Google账户同步数据的方法:

  1. 在Pop!_OS上,登录Google账户,并确保同步设置开启。
  2. 在安卓设备上,同样登录相同的Google账户,并开启同步设置。
  3. 现在,你的文件、日历、联系人等信息将在两个设备之间自动同步。

3.2 使用第三方应用程序

一些第三方应用程序可以帮助用户在不同操作系统之间同步数据。以下是一些常用的应用程序:

  • Dropsync:Dropsync是一个跨平台的应用程序,可以在Linux、Windows和MacOS之间同步文件。
  • SyncThing:SyncThing是一个开源的文件同步解决方案,支持多种设备和操作系统。

3.3 使用ADB命令

ADB(Android Debug Bridge)是Android设备开发人员常用的工具,它也可以用于在Pop!_OS和安卓设备之间同步数据。

以下是一个使用ADB命令同步安卓设备文件到Pop!_OS的示例:

adb pull /path/to/Android/file /path/to/Pop_OS/directory 

在这个命令中,/path/to/Android/file是安卓设备上的文件路径,而/path/to/Pop_OS/directory是Pop!_OS上的目标目录。

四、结论

虽然Pop!_OS和安卓设备之间的同步存在一些挑战,但通过使用Google账户、第三方应用程序和ADB命令,用户可以实现无缝同步。这些方法不仅提高了生产效率,还增强了用户在不同设备之间切换和使用数据的体验。